This best form tier list ranks combat forms separately from saber hilts. Forms change combo length, ACC requirements, and swing rhythm — the stats that decide whether you win a duel when stamina drops below thirty percent. Rankings reflect June 2026 in-game testing and official unlock routes.
Basic forms such as Juyo, Makashi, and Ataru unlock purely through kill milestones — no NPC required. Character forms demand faction alignment plus map-specific quests: Darth Vader on Death Star (Darth Sith rank), Darth Maul near Camp rock piles (Sith Lord+), Kit Fisto inside Coruscant temple (Jedi Knight+), and Cal on Kamino (third-leaf Jedi, 100 kills and a five-kill streak).
Yellow-style medium forms and Red-style heavy forms remain the best starting picks for learners because they teach ACC stacking without faction gates. Yellow chains reach four hits versus Red three-hit bursts — pick Yellow when learning footwork, Red when you read Perfect Blocks consistently.
Revisit this list after every patch. Developer notes on the Roblox page mention ongoing balance work; a quest form that feels A-tier today may shift when ACC caps change.
Faction alignment locks you out of opposite-side forms — you cannot grab Darth Vader form while aligned Jedi. Plan your grind before spending Credits on Sith or Jedi cosmetics you cannot use.

Saber Unbound form unlock routes (verified NPC names)
- Juyo, Makashi, Ataru, and other kill forms — Earn kills in PvP or PvE — forms unlock progressively without NPCs. Juyo, Makashi, and Ataru are among the baseline kill unlocks.
- Darth Vader form — Sith alignment, Darth rank, Death Star map — enter the unlabeled hallway from Hangar Two toward Empire rooms and interact with the Vader NPC.
- Darth Maul form — Camp map — walk toward the rock pile spawn area and interact with Maul; requires Sith Lord rank minimum.
- Kit Fisto form — Coruscant — enter the temple meeting area, find Kit Fisto inside; requires Jedi Knight rank on the Jedi faction path.
- Cal form — Kamino — locate Cal near the Grand Inquisitor cluster; third-leaf Jedi rank, 100 kills, and a five-kill streak complete his quest.
Saber Unbound duel tips for any form
- Walk during trades — every best form in Saber Unbound assumes walking Block Point recovery, not sprint trading.
- Stack ACC before chasing ACM damage — whiffing resets your pressure regardless of form tier.
- Match form to faction plan before grinding — Vader and Maul require Sith alignment; Fisto and Cal require Jedi.
- Pull opponents who sprint; running increases damage taken in Saber Unbound duels per community stamina guides.
- Cross-check quest rank labels on NPCs — the UI shows whether you meet Sith Lord or Darth requirements before accepting quests.
Saber Unbound best form FAQ
Why is Yellow often called the best form in Saber Unbound?
The fourth combo hit and balanced ACC requirement forgive minor mistakes while teaching stamina control — ideal for June 2026 duel meta before you chase faction quest forms.
Does this Saber Unbound best form tier list apply to team fights?
No — this list targets 1v1 realistic duels. Team modes reward different Force picks and saber reach.
Can Jedi unlock Darth Vader form in Saber Unbound?
No — character forms require matching faction alignment. Swap to Sith before starting the Death Star Vader quest chain.
How is the best form in Saber Unbound different from the saber tier list?
Forms change combo patterns and unlock rules; saber hilts change reach, drain, and swing count. Use both pages — tier list hub for hilts, this page for forms.
